实验(一)UML建模基础及用例图实验目的1、熟悉UML建模工具RationalRose的基本菜单及操作。2、掌握UML的可见性规则和构造型的作用。3、掌握用例的概念;掌握UML用例图的组成及作用。4、掌握用例与用例之间的各种关系。实验内容1、练习使用建模工具建立各种UML图形,并对图形进行相应编辑和修改。2、认识各种UML关系,并用工具表示出来。3、什么是用例?用例图中有哪些组成元素?在UML中是如何表示的?答:用例是参与者可以感受到的系统服务或功能单元。用例图的组成部分是参与者、用例、系统边界和关联。参与者用人形图标表示,用例图用椭圆形符号表示,连线表示它们之间的关系。4、用例与用例之间的包含关系、扩展关系和泛化关系各代表什么含义?它们之间有何区别?对以上三种关系各举一例,画出用例图,并进行说明。答:包含关系:是指用例可以简单的包含其他用例具有的行为,并把它所包含的用例行为作为自身行为的一部分。扩展关系:在一定条件下,把新的行为加入到已有的用例中,获得的新的用例叫做扩展用例,原有的用例叫做基础用例,从扩展用例到基础用例的关系